Recognizing SMILE Eye Surgical Procedure



When thinking about SMILE Eye Surgery, it's important to comprehend the treatment and its advantages. SMILE, which represents Tiny Incision Lenticule Extraction, is a minimally invasive laser eye surgical procedure that corrects typical vision issues like myopia (nearsightedness).

Throughout the treatment, your eye surgeon will utilize a femtosecond laser to create a little incision in your cornea. With this cut, a little disc of tissue called a lenticule is removed, reshaping the cornea and remedying your vision.

Among the vital advantages of SMILE Eye Surgery is its quick healing time. Several individuals experience enhanced vision within a day or more after the procedure, with minimal pain.

Additionally, SMILE is known for its high success price in giving lasting vision correction. Unlike LASIK, SMILE does not need the production of a flap in the cornea, minimizing the danger of difficulties and permitting a much more stable corneal framework post-surgery.

Pros and Cons of SMILE



Thinking About SMILE Eye Surgery for vision adjustment features different advantages and prospective drawbacks.

Among the primary pros of SMILE is its minimally intrusive nature, as it involves a little cut and generally leads to quick recuperation times. The treatment is also recognized for creating minimal pain and completely dry eye symptoms post-surgery contrasted to other vision improvement techniques. Additionally, SMILE has been revealed to give outstanding aesthetic results, with many individuals achieving 20/20 vision or far better.

On the other hand, a prospective con of SMILE is that it may not appropriate for people with serious refractive errors, as the treatment array is rather restricted compared to LASIK. An additional factor to consider is that the knowing curve for surgeons executing SMILE can affect the schedule of knowledgeable suppliers in specific locations.

Identifying Eligibility for SMILE



To determine if you're eligible for SMILE eye surgery, your optometrist will certainly perform an extensive analysis of your eye health and vision requirements. During this evaluation, factors such as the security of your vision prescription, the density of your cornea, and the overall wellness of your eyes will certainly be assessed.

Normally, prospects for SMILE more than 22 years of ages, have a stable vision prescription for at the very least a year, and have healthy corneas without conditions like keratoconus.
